O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.119(d)(3)(i)(B): Information pertaining to the equipment in the process did not include piping and instrument diagrams (P&ID's): a) On or about 11/20/19, ammonia sensors AD-001, AD-002. and AD003 were not listed on the piping and instrument diagrams. NO ABATEMENT CERTIFICATION REQUIRED

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.119(f)(1): The employer did not develop and implement written operating procedures that provided clear instructions for safely conducting activities involved in each covered process consistent with the process safety information addressing at least the elements listed in 1910.119(f)(1)(i)(A)-1910.119(f)(1)(iv): a) On or about 11/20/19, written operating procedure SOP-EQ-507: High Pressure Receiver HPR-1 (revision date 2/27/14) did not include clear instructions for safely conducting activities involved in each covered process consistent with the process safety information addressing at least the elements listed in 1910.119(f)(1)(i)(A)-1910.119(f)(1)(iv) such as Operating limits; consequences of deviation and steps required to correct or avoid the deviation; Quality control for raw materials and control of hazardous chemical inventory levels; and Safety systems and their functions. ABATEMENT CERTIFICATION REQUIRED
